In 1997, Johns Hopkins researchers discovered that broccoli seeds and three-day-old
broccoli sprouts contain a compound converted to sulforaphane when the seed and sprout
cells are crushed. Five grams of three-day-old broccoli sprouts contain as much sulforaphane
as 150 grams of mature broccoli. The sulforaphane levels in other cruciferous vegetables have
not yet been calculated.


Adverse Effects Associated with This Food


Enlarged thyroid gland (goiter). Cruciferous vegetables, including kohlrabi, contain goitrin,
thiocyanate, and isothiocyanate. These chemicals, known collectively as goitrogens, inhibit
the formation of thyroid hormones and cause the thyroid to enlarge in an attempt to pro-
duce more. Goitrogens are not hazardous for healthy people who eat moderate amounts of
cruciferous vegetables, but they may pose problems for people who have a thyroid condition
or are taking thyroid medication.
